How to plumb the depths of the Cosmos to decipher the mystery of our origins.
Distant 'worlds' that are different from our own, glimpsed through the most powerful telescopes on Earth or in space, are a source of beauty and emotion, as well as new scientific challenges.
At the crossroads of visual art, sound and documentary, the film Kumulipo, directed by Gérard Kosicki in partnership with astrophysics researcher Jérôme Bouvier, offers a poetic immersion in the Universe, rooted in the constant advance of our knowledge.
13.8 billion years have passed since the emergence of space-time. Today, we can see what we don't yet know...
